What I Looked for in Sound Quality
My main focus during the test was sound performance. I wanted to know whether the Play:5 Gen 1 could still deliver rich audio by today’s standards. I found that it produces strong bass, clear mids, and a wide soundstage for a single speaker. In my opinion, it works especially well for larger rooms because the sound fills space easily.
Connectivity and Setup Experience
I paid close attention to setup because older smart speakers can sometimes be frustrating. In my case, the Sonos system was fairly easy to connect, especially if you already use other Sonos products. I did notice that the Gen 1 model is limited compared to newer speakers, so I made sure to check compatibility before relying on it for daily use.
Why I Considered Compatibility Important
One of the biggest things I learned from my test is that compatibility matters a lot with the Sonos Play:5 Gen 1. Since it is an older model, I had to verify which apps, services, and Sonos features still work with it. I would recommend checking this carefully before buying, especially if you want full support for modern streaming features.
My Thoughts on Value for Money
For me, the Play:5 Gen 1 makes sense only if the price is right. I think it can still be a great buy on the used market if you want strong sound and already use Sonos. However, I would not pay too much for it because newer models offer better support, updated features, and more future-proof performance.

What I Would Check Before Buying
Before I buy a used Sonos Play:5 Gen 1, I always check:
- Physical condition of the speaker
- Whether it powers on properly
- Wi-Fi and app connectivity
- Compatibility with my current Sonos setup
- Seller reputation and return policy
